嵌入式系统的安全性挑战与对策

2024-01-27 00:26

嵌入式系统的安全性挑战与对策

1. 引言

随着科技的快速发展,嵌入式系统已经广泛应用于工业控制、智能家居、汽车电子等领域。随着应用范围的扩大,嵌入式系统的安全性问题也日益凸显。如何应对这些安全挑战,提高嵌入式系统的安全性,已成为当前亟待解决的问题。

2. 安全性挑战

嵌入式系统面临的安全性挑战主要包括硬件攻击、软件漏洞、网络威胁和数据隐私泄露等方面。

2.1 硬件攻击

硬件攻击是指通过物理手段破坏嵌入式系统的硬件设备,或者通过非法获取硬件设备的控制权,进而窃取或篡改数据。这种攻击方式直接威胁到嵌入式系统的数据安全和稳定性。

2.2 软件漏洞

嵌入式系统软件漏洞是黑客攻击的主要途径。黑客可以利用这些漏洞获取系统的控制权,窃取或篡改数据,甚至破坏整个系统。

2.3 网络威胁

嵌入式系统通常与网络相连,这使得它们容易受到网络威胁。网络攻击者可以通过网络注入恶意代码、窃取数据或破坏系统。

2.4 数据隐私泄露

嵌入式系统处理的数据往往涉及用户的隐私信息,如个人信息、位置信息等。如果这些信息被非法获取,将给用户带来严重的安全隐患。

3. 对策

针对以上安全性挑战,可以采取以下对策:

3.1 硬件安全设计

采用硬件安全芯片、可信执行环境等技术手段,保证数据的机密性和完整性。同时,加强对硬件设备的物理保护,防止非法获取控制权。

3.2 软件安全防护

加强软件安全设计,采用防病毒软件、防火墙等技术手段,防止黑客利用漏洞进行攻击。同时,定期进行软件更新和漏洞修补,提高系统的安全性。

3.3 网络安全隔离

通过设置网络安全隔离区,将重要系统与不安全的网络环境隔离开来。同时,加强对网络数据的监控和过滤,及时发现并阻止网络攻击。

3.4 数据加密与权限控制

采用数据加密技术,确保数据在传输和存储过程中不被窃取或篡改。同时,实施严格的权限控制策略,限制用户对数据的访问权限,防止数据泄露。

4. 结论

随着嵌入式系统的广泛应用,其安全性问题越来越受到关注。本文分析了嵌入式系统面临的安全性挑战,并提出了相应的对策。为了提高嵌入式系统的安全性,需要在硬件、软件、网络和数据等多个方面进行综合防护。未来,还需要进一步加强研究,完善嵌入式系统的安全防护体系,确保其安全可靠地运行。